Ingredients:
1/4 cup butter or margarine, softened |
1 cup sugar |
3 eggs, beaten |
1/2 cup sherry |
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on |
1 cup chopped stewed figs |
2 cups stale breadcrumbs |
1 cup chopped pecans |
hard sauce |
Directions:
1. Cream butter in a large mixing bowl; gradually add sugar, beating well. Add eggs; beat well. Add sherry and cinnamon; mix well. Stir in figs, breadcrumbs, and pecans. 2. Spoon mixture into a well-greased 1-quart pudding mold, and cover tightly with lid. 3. Place mold on a shallow rack in a large stock pot with enough boiling water to come halfway up mold. Cover pot; let simmer 3 hours, replenishing water as needed. Unmold and serve with Hard Sauce. Store leftover pudding in refrigerator; reheat before serving. |
